Roll for clothes in the Surprise-o-Matic (free)
The Surprise-O-Matic in Infinity Nikki is a permanent gacha-style machine where players can use Bling, the in-game currency, to roll for clothing pieces. Each pull costs 20,000 Bling, and there is also an option to do 10 pulls for 200,000 Bling. The machine offers a variety of clothing items ranging from common 3-star pieces to rare 5-star outfits, but it does not have a pity system, so luck plays a significant role in obtaining high-rarity items. While it can be tempting to try early on, it is generally recommended to save Bling and use the Surprise-O-Matic once you have excess currency, typically in mid to late game. The machine is located near the Florawish Stylist’s Guild, and players get a free first draw, making it a good way to try for new clothes without initial cost.

Outside of the Stylist’s Guild in Florawish, there’s a gachapon machine that you can use bling on to roll. It costs a whopping 20,000 Bling for one pull (and 200,000 blind to pull 10 times at once), so you’ll want to spend wisely here, as you’ll need Bling to upgrade your gear as well.
Buy clothes from NPCs and shops (free)
In Infinity Nikki, you can easily expand your wardrobe by buying clothes from various NPCs and shops scattered throughout the game world. Look for NPCs with a shirt icon above their heads or buildings marked with the same symbol on your map to find clothing vendors. These shops, such as Marques Boutique in Florawish, offer a range of casual clothing and accessories that can be purchased using in-game currency like Bling, which is earned through quests and exploration. This method provides a straightforward, free way to gather outfit pieces perfect for completing looks without spending real money. Exploring different towns thoroughly can reveal unique vendors with exclusive items, helping you build a diverse collection for styling challenges and everyday wear.

Look out for NPCs with a shirt icon above their head or for buildings marked with the shirt icon on the map, as these NPCs and shops will sell clothes! These pieces are much more simple, but are great for if you want to actually make an outfit. Since the gacha mainly offers dresses, these stores offer more casual pieces for Nikki’s everyday wear.
Beat NPCs in styling duels (free)
To beat NPCs in styling duels for free in Infinity Nikki, focus on selecting clothing items that best match the theme of each Style Challenge, such as Elegant, Cool, Sweet, Fresh, or Sexy. Each clothing piece has hidden stats rated from D to S for these themes, so prioritize items with higher ratings to maximize your score. Accessories have limits, so diversify your wardrobe to avoid relying solely on them. You can expand your collection by unlocking outfits through gameplay rewards, quests, and free events rather than spending real money. Winning these duels not only advances the story but also grants valuable rewards and new clothing sketches to craft more stylish outfits for Nikki.

Some of the faction NPCs you need to take down in styling duels will offer you clothing sketches if you beat them. You can check which ones give what via the “factions” button on the Pear-Pal menu. Note that they give sketches, which means you’ll need to craft the actual clothing once you unlock the recipe.

Trade Dew of Inspiration to Kilo the Cadenceborn (free)
In Infinity Nikki, you can trade Dew of Inspiration to Kilo the Cadenceborn for exclusive rewards, including special outfit pieces. To do this, you first need to complete the “Hello, Cadenceborn!” side quest at Memorial Mountain. Once unlocked, you can find Kilo near the Old Florawish Memorial and exchange collected Dew of Inspiration-small glowing orbs found throughout the game world-for various rewards. As you level up your relationship with Kilo by trading Dew, you unlock outfit sets such as Rebirth Wish, Hometown Breeze, and Starwish Echoes, along with valuable items like Mira EXP, Bling, diamonds, and crafting materials. This is a free and rewarding way to expand your wardrobe and gain useful resources in the game.

You can trade in those glowing blue-purple globs you’ve collected around the world with this. dragon creature in the Memorial Mountains to unlock more clothing. They’ll give you different pieces of outfit sets as you hand over more and more dew.

What’s the fastest way to unlock all Miracle outfits in Infinity Nikki
The fastest way to unlock all Miracle outfits in Infinity Nikki is to focus on progressing through the main storyline up to at least Chapter 8, as each chapter grants inspiration for a new piece of the Miracle Outfit, which you then unlock via the Heart of Infinity skill tree by spending Bling and Whimstars.
For specific Miracle outfits like the Sea of Stars, you need to collect special materials such as Ethereal Stars by completing daily duties and exploring the Sea of Stars area, though this can be time-gated since you can only collect a few per day.
To speed up unlocking:
-
Prioritize completing main story quests promptly to receive inspiration nodes unlocking Miracle Outfit sketches.
-
Regularly collect and save Bling and Whimstars to unlock these sketches immediately when available.
-
Complete daily tasks and faction battles to gather rare crafting materials efficiently.
-
Use the Heart of Infinity grid strategically to unlock outfit nodes as soon as you get inspiration.
-
Follow event quests and interlude chapters that are part of the Miracle Outfit questlines to gather necessary components and trigger cutscenes unlocking further outfit parts.
This combined approach of story progression, resource farming, and daily activity completion is the fastest route to fully unlocking all Miracle outfits in Infinity Nikki.
